Responsibilities
An exciting opportunity for an experienced Administrator has arisen to provide administration support for the care of children with diabetes. This role requires a person who can provide senior secretarial and administrative support to a number of clinicians including complex correspondence, minutes, clinical audits and effective and sensitive communication to parents and carers. The post holder will need to have extensive experience using Microsoft Excel/spreadsheet management to support data capture and reporting.
It is your responsibility to ensure the highest standard of service delivery within the speciality team, providing senior secretarial and administrative support to senior clinicians, organising clinics and coordinating the team schedule. You will balance the needs of the service with staff requirements, ensuring continuity of an effective service.
